Leggi tuttoA traumatic event sends a musician (Sedgwick) back to her hometown in an effort to reunite with the daughters she abandoned. To do so, she must confront her abusive ex-husband (Quinn), from whom she fled years ago.A traumatic event sends a musician (Sedgwick) back to her hometown in an effort to reunite with the daughters she abandoned. To do so, she must confront her abusive ex-husband (Quinn), from whom she fled years ago.

I was engaged by the movie. Thought the plot was believable enough, the direction good and the acting superior. One of my favorite sleeper films. Also the title song has remained with me, many months later.
I thought the film dealt well with a number of real human situations involving sibling rivalry, sickness and death, the contrast between rural and urban lifestyles, the breakup of the nuclear family, etc. And I wound up caring about all of the main characters. I don't ask much more of a movie.
It does have an indy feel to it, but I thought that added to the charm. I would definitely add it to my library and watch it every now and then.

This is a nice movie in spite of the low rating that viewers have given it. And I'm not surprised that it got such ratings. Most Americans would not like this movie because it doesn't have enough action. This is a movie about real life relationships, past and present; about how different people adapt to changing situations; and about how life's decisions are made. This is a movie about how real people live, what they say, and how they love. I especially liked the ending. I think most of the acting was good too. I thought all three of Delia's daughters did a fine job. I especially liked her youngest daughter, Cissy; wise beyond her years. I can remember her from "The Blue Car". I was so frustrated with Amanda's rote religious jumbo that I wanted her mother to grab her and give her a good shaking. But if you love someone enough, I suppose you often put up with that sort of thing.
I thought this was an important movie.......it wasn't fun to watch, but it was real. I am glad to have watched it. I think it makes you a better person to see some of the ways that people can suffer and try to understand their spirits. I think Kyra did a good job with this role. She showed us how you can be strong and weak at the same time. How you can hate and love at the same time. How your actions are so important and what you do with your life. That being a victim isn't always a choice - but sometimes it is a hard choice. I also liked how the kids didn't perfectly forgive her or come out OK in the end. They are broken and different. I think this is a good movie
I saw `Cavedweller' at the Tribeca Film Festival. I haven't read the book, but this movie is only a small part of the book.
Kyra Sedgwick once again proves herself to be a very versatile actress, she's amazing in this movie as her character struggles with her emotions. All three daughters do a wonderful job, but Regan Arnold stands out as the fish-out-of-water youngest daughter, moved suddenly from L.A. to small-town Georgia. Aidan Quinn is very strong in a rather ugly role. Kevin Bacon has a bit part but is wonderful, as always. Jill Scott, in what I believe is her acting debut, is wonderful and provides some needed light-hearted moments in the midst of all the heavy drama. Jackie Burroughs is terrific as the tough-as-nails grandmother.
If you want to watch a romantic comedy, then this movie is not the one for you. If you want to watch a solid drama with excellent writing and acting, this movie will leave you more than satisfied.

- QuizKevin Bacon and Kyra Sedgwick also appeared in Lemon Sky (1988), Pyrates (1991), Murder in the First (1995), The Woodsman (2004), and Loverboy (2005).
